Rs.23060 Million New Floating Storage and Regasification Unit in Ganjam, Odisha
Executive Summary: A new Floating Storage and Regasification Unit (FSRU)-based LNG terminal and jetty is planned at Gopalpur Port in Badaputi, Chamakhandi, Ganjam, Odisha. The project, estimated at ₹23,060 million, has been submitted for environmental clearance to the Ministry of Environment, Forest and Climate Change and is currently under review as of July 2025.
Rs.46063 Million Offshore Blocks Development Project in Konaseema, Andhra Pradesh
Executive Summary: A major offshore development project is planned in Odalarevu, Konaseema, Andhra Pradesh, involving drilling of 10 wells, installation of two unmanned platforms, offshore pipeline laying, and an onshore gas processing facility. With an estimated cost of Rs. 46,063.5 million, construction will begin in October 2025 and conclude by October 2035. Environmental clearance is under Expert Appraisal Committee review
